To diagnose ADHD the doctor must examine the patient in a variety of settings and interview a few different people. The doctor should also be in a position to rule out other conditions that may cause the symptoms, like depression and anxiety. Additionally the symptoms must be present in two or more circumstances and cause a significant issue for the patient. Doctors frequently use checklists to detect adult ADHD symptoms. However, personal experience is equally important and can uncover information that may not be reflected on questionnaires.

In the UK it is possible to get an assessment for ADHD through the NHS or privately. The NHS generally has longer wait times, however you can get an assessment via the "Right to Choose". However, this is only accessible in England and Scotland.

If you are considering an ADHD diagnosis, you should ask your GP for a referral to a specialist psychologist or psychiatrist. The NHS is legally obliged to offer these services. The Right to Choose pathway is the fastest way to get an appointment. It allows patients to choose their own mental health professional, and can reduce the time it takes to wait.

The medications available to patients suffering from ADHD vary, and can include stimulants, a type of antidepressant, and an amalgamation of both. The medication is generally effective for a majority of people. However, it may cause side effects. These side effects can be mild and usually disappear in time. If side effects are severe or disrupt daily activities, a doctor may consider alternative treatments.

It is essential to remember that a diagnosis of ADHD only makes sense when the symptoms are apparent across a variety of areas. If the condition is not properly assessed then the diagnosis of ADHD can be a false one which could lead to untreated symptoms.
